Turkey/Syria-
Turkish efforts in Idlib have been hampered due to Russian control of the airspace over the region. Erdogan warned on Feb. 5 that the Syrian regime forces must withdraw from the area that was designated as a de-escalation zone in Idlib until the end of February, signaling a new military operation if the threat against Turkey’s military posts in the area continues.

Israel/Gaza-
In an interview on Tuesday, Israel’s Defense Minister Naftali Bennett said that a major ground offensive into Gaza to stop the terrorism threat of rockets/mortars into southern Israel will happen in the “near future”. There is general support for such an operation given the regularity of rocket/mortar attacks. Hints are of a surprise attack. Inference was also made that supporting sites in Syria, mostly storage and some manufacturing facilities, will also be hit.

Israel/Hezbollah
Breaking this morning are unconfirmed reports of a senior Hezbollah leader - Imad al-Tawil - being taken out over night by a drone strike in the Golan area. He was in charge of coordinating operations in the Golan. No confirmation yet from Hezbollah, but if so the unfolding of their response needs close monitoring. Additionally, this would confirm the presence of Hezbollah operations in Syria. Current (last couple hours) of a lot of reported IAF activity over the Golan and Lebanon.

Iran -
Iranian efforts to expand their control in Iraq and Syria are not producing the desired results. Despite the much reduced budget for operations in Syria, the Iranian Quds Force officers in charge convinced their bosses back in Iran that more cash was needed. Cash will become harder to get if the corona virus outbreaks continues to expand in Iran as it currently appears on track to do. That and continued pressure by Israel through destruction of Iranian bases and storage facilities will make money dry up even quicker.
